Franklin Oaks is not a good place to live. For one, the prices are outrageous for what you get. Yes, I know this is not the Four Seasons but if I'm paying $773 a month (normallly the apartment I was in would rent for over $900 which is ridiculous), I expect for the stairs I have to use to reach my apartment to not shake and make terrible sounds and wobble all over the place. The metal was completely rusted and they were unattached from the support beams when I moved in. I reported it and they fixed them...11 months later.
I also expect my air conditioning to work. I'm not an expert but I do know that when the apartment is 90 degrees that changing a filter will not make the temperature drop down to 75. The maintenance men are insulting in that they think the residents are idiots. The office staff is a joke. If you have a problem, DO NOT SPEAK with a leasing agent. They have no authority and don't know what the hell they are talking about. The staff will claim they posted notices regarding policy changes. They may have posted it in their office but if you live on the other side of the street and have no reason to go to the office, how are you going to know of changes' I have worked at apartment complexes and I know that this place sucks. They are cheap but they want to charge ridiculous rental rates. Please, for your own peace of mind, do not live in Franklin Oaks.
